Method

1

Pulire il calamaro, rimuovendo la sacca e la pelle, e sciacquarlo sotto acqua fredda. Asciugare con carta assorbente.

2

Tritare finemente i filetti di merluzzo e i gamberetti, quindi mescolarli in una ciotola con la quinoa cotta, il prezzemolo, l'aglio, sale e pepe.

3

Riempire il calamaro con il composto, lasciando un centimetro libero in cima, e chiudere l'apertura con uno stuzzicadenti.

4

Frullare il pomodoro e la cipolla con l'olio, la paprika, il succo di limone, sale e pepe fino a ottenere una salsa liscia.

5

Versare la salsa in una pirofila, posizionare il calamaro ripieno e coprire con carta alluminio.

6

Cuocere in forno preriscaldato a 180°C per 30 minuti, poi rimuovere la copertura e continuare a cuocere per altri 10 minuti.

7

Servire caldo, guarnito con spicchi di limone.
